About 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ine
3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ine (PubChem CID 112962390) has the molecular formula C17H16ClN5O
and a molecular weight of 341.80 g/mol. Its IUPAC name is 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ine.

What is the SMILES notation for 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ine?
The canonical SMILES for 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ine is COc1ccc(Cl)cc1Nc1nncc(N(C)c2ccccc2)n1.
What is the InChIKey of 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ine?
The InChIKey is WDDUBKLVGRRWOO-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H16ClN5O/c1-23(13-6-4-3-5-7-13)16-11-19-22-17(21-16)20-14-10-12(18)8-9-15(14)24-2/h3-11H,1-2H3,(H,20,21,22).
What are the key properties of 3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ine?
3-N-(5-chloro-2-methoxyphenyl)-5-N-methyl-5-N-phenyl-1,2,4-triazine-3,5-diamine has a molecular weight of 341.80 g/mol, XLogP of 4.05, 5 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
